The ICU staff is responsible for providing comprehensive care to critically ill patients admitted in the Intensive Care Unit. They ensure continuous monitoring, timely interventions, and coordination with doctors and healthcare teams to deliver safe and quality patient care.

**Key Responsibilities**:

- Monitor and assess patients’ vital signs, medical conditions, and progress.
- Provide direct nursing care including administering medications, IV therapy, ventilator support, and other critical care procedures.
- Assist doctors during medical procedures and emergency interventions.
- Maintain accurate and timely patient records, charts, and reports.
- Operate and manage ICU medical equipment (ventilators, defibrillators, monitors, infusion pumps, etc.).
- Ensure infection control protocols and safety measures are strictly followed.
- Provide emotional support and communication to patients’ families regarding the patient’s condition.
-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ams for comprehensive patient management.
- Respond quickly and effectively in medical emergencies such as cardiac arrest, respiratory failure, or trauma cases.
- Participate in training, drills, and continuous medical education for skill enhancement.

**Required Qualifications & Skills**:

- GNM / B.Sc. Nursing / M.Sc. Nursing or equivalent medical qualification.
- Prior experience in ICU/Critical Care preferred.
- Strong knowledge of critical care procedures, equipment, and protocols.
- Excellent decision-making and quick response skills in emergencies.
- Good communication and teamwork abilities.
- Compassionate and patient-centered approach.
